Output e87bea7a324fb8a179d44de4e54afdf2373ca39f343e222a77362fc8a1a0edc8:0

value
647116
script pubkey
OP_0 OP_PUSHBYTES_20 a4350d4506127a646e27a535fe2050cc0dee7b09
address
bc1q5s6s63gxzfaxgm38556lugzsesx7u7cfvykeks
transaction
e87bea7a324fb8a179d44de4e54afdf2373ca39f343e222a77362fc8a1a0edc8
confirmations
64020
spent
true